Gas Water Heater Operation

Gas water heaters utilize the combustion of natural gas or propane to heat water. The process involves several key components:

  • Gas Burner: The gas burner ignites the fuel, generating heat.
  • Heat Exchanger: The heat from the burner transfers to the heat exchanger, which contains the water to be heated.
  • Flue: Combustion gases escape through the flue, ensuring proper ventilation.

Electricity’s Role

Electricity plays a limited role in the operation of a gas water heater. It primarily powers the following components:

  • Ignition System: An electrical spark ignites the gas burner.
  • Thermostat: The thermostat monitors the water temperature and adjusts the gas flow accordingly.
  • Safety Controls: Electrical safety controls monitor critical parameters, such as flame presence and water pressure.

Power Outage Scenarios

When a power outage occurs, the following scenarios may arise:

Scenario 1: Standing Pilot Water Heaters

Standing pilot water heaters feature a small, continuously burning pilot flame. In a power outage, the pilot flame remains lit, ensuring uninterrupted water heating.

Scenario 2: Electronic Ignition Water Heaters

Electronic ignition water heaters rely on electricity to ignite the burner. During a power outage, they cannot operate.
